Summerwood, Columbus, OH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Summerw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Summerwood Studio Apartments | $972 | $785 | $1,134 |
| Summerw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,363 | $895 | $2,526 |
| Summerw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,874 | $1,200 | $5,796 |
| Summerw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,460 | $1,766 | $5,934 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Summerwood
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Summerwood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Summerwood ranges from $895 to $2,526 with an average monthly rent of $1,363.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Summerwood c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Summerwood range from $1,200 to $5,796.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,874.
How expensive are Summerwood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Summerwood on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,766 to $5,934 - averaging $3,460 for the location.
